Output d8689b8c394f6a869b38a2fbbef8557918fd965e95cd6bce3ae81c05f1e84fd0:0

value
7028593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937acdf44df0f7f7ceca6ae58effc1509e2f9c27 OP_EQUAL
address
MMLxgEecKkcCur7nZXJUS7TrnR33ew5UAf
transaction
d8689b8c394f6a869b38a2fbbef8557918fd965e95cd6bce3ae81c05f1e84fd0
spent
true